Frequently Asked Questions
The Amerock cabinet edge pull is made of high-quality aluminum. This ensures durability and a long-lasting finish.
The Amerock edge pull measures four and nine sixteenths inches in center-to-center spacing. Its overall length is seven point seventy-five inches.
The Amerock cabinet edge pull is finished in satin nickel. This finish provides a classic and versatile look for various design styles.
